Leaves



 

Leaves fall,
tawny hued litter of the path
poignant memory of summers warm caress.

 

Leaves fall,
tears flowing down the dryads cheek
mourning years glacial progression.

 

Leaves fall
pennants of arboreal magnificence
surrendered to autumns chill.

 

Leaves fall,
tattered corpses shrouding the earth
clawing at the unwary soul.

 

Leaves fall,
entombed within the hoar frosts grasp
seeking gentle oblivion.
